I had turned on the zoning/wetland/flood zone layer, but when I printed the pdf map the only thing that showed up was the parcel boundaries and the aerial photos. Why is this?
A. Currently, the pdf maps are only set up to print parcel boundaries, aerial photos at a scale of 1″ = 400′ or larger, and road names. Hopefully, in a future version of the Spatial Data Viewer, the pdf maps will be more interactive. Q. I have the aerial photos turned on, but when I print a map, they don’t show up. A. If you are printing an html map, try zooming in a little bit farther. If you are printing a pdf map, make sure the scale you select is 1″ = 50′, 1″ = 100′, 1″ = 200′ or 1″ = 400′.
